Hi everyone, I have registered for F2, F3 and F7 for June 2015 session. I currently work in a financial reporting department (bank sector), so I am pretty confident with f3 and f7. On the other hand, F2 is not really my cup of tea, so I am struggling a little with it…. My question is: what happens if I do not manage to pass f2 in June (or if I choose not to sit the exam)? Will my F7 exam be considered invalid since students are supposed to complete all the “knowledge” exams before taking any “skills” exams? Thanks in advance!
As far as I’m concerned you have to finish F1-F3 before moving to F4-F9
You may pass F7 before F2!
So long as you have entered for F2 then you are able to attempt and pass F7 and potentially fail (or not attend for) the F2 exam
